What is Lionel Messi Net Worth?
Lionel Messi’s net worth is estimated at an astonishing $600 million (as of 2023). This wealth comes from both his lucrative football contracts and his off-field earnings, such as endorsements, sponsorships, and partnerships with leading brands. Over the years, Messi has become a global icon, further increasing his value far beyond the soccer field.

How Did Messi Build His Fortune?
Lionel Messi built his wealth through three primary channels:
1. Football Contracts
Messi’s career began at FC Barcelona, where, by 2017, he’d signed the most expensive contract in football history—a four-year deal worth €555 million (about $674 million). After leaving Barcelona, he joined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) and now plays for Inter Miami CF. These deals have consistently made Messi one of the highest-earning players in global sports.
2. Endorsements & Partnerships
Off the pitch, Messi has built an empire through endorsements. Some of his notable brand collaborations include:
- Adidas: Messi has been the face of Adidas for years, earning millions annually to represent the brand.
- PepsiCo: A long-term partnership includes commercials and sponsorships in global campaigns.
- Budweiser: Recently, Messi signed an endorsement deal as the face of the beer brand.
It’s clear that his global fame makes him a preferred choice for advertisers trying to connect with fans worldwide.
3. Lucrative Investments
Investing has played a vital role in Lionel Messi’s growing wealth. Some highlights include:
- Real Estate: Messi has a property portfolio including luxurious residences in Barcelona, Miami, and Argentina.
- The Messi Store: Messi ventured into the fashion industry with his clothing line, further diversifying his portfolio.
How Does Messi Spend His Money?
All that wealth naturally fuels a lifestyle that’s as luxurious as you’d expect from a global superstar. A closer look:
Luxurious Homes
Messi resides in a sprawling mansion in Barcelona, worth over $7 million, which features a football field, a gym, and separate sections for rest and leisure. He also owns lavish properties in Argentina, Ibiza, and Miami.
Private Jets
Messi travels in style with his private jet, valued at around $15 million. Besides being a necessity for constant travel, his jet doubles as a symbol of his exquisite taste.
Cars
Messi’s car collection is breathtaking. Highlights include:
- Ferrari 335 S Spider Scaglietti – $35 million (perhaps his most famous car purchase)
- Maserati GranTurismo MC Stradale – $242,000
- Audi R8 and a few Range Rovers
Philanthropic Efforts
Beyond spending on himself, Messi also gives back. His Leo Messi Foundation supports healthcare and education initiatives for underprivileged children across the globe.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is Lionel Messi’s current salary?
Lionel Messi earns an estimated $12 million annually from his football contracts alone. Inter Miami CF has reportedly offered bonuses in partnership with brands like Apple and Adidas.
What brands does Lionel Messi endorse?
Messi endorses top-tier brands like Adidas, PepsiCo, Budweiser, Mastercard, and Gatorade. He has also collaborated with luxury fashion lines.
Is Messi richer than Ronaldo?
While both are among the wealthiest athletes globally, Lionel Messi’s net worth, estimated at $600 million, is slightly lower than Cristiano Ronaldo’s, which hovers around $690 million (depending on investments).
What other businesses does Messi own?
Messi owns several assets, including the clothing brand The Messi Store, real estate investments, and partnerships with companies aiming to use his likeness for merchandise.
